Sagging roof repair services focus on addressing issues caused by a roof that has begun to dip, sag, or bow downward. This problem often results from structural deterioration, water damage, or the failure of supporting materials like trusses or rafters. When a roof starts to sag, it can compromise the integrity of the entire roofing system, making it more vulnerable to leaks, wind damage, or even collapse in severe cases. Local contractors specializing in sagging roof repair can evaluate the extent of the problem, identify the underlying causes, and implement solutions to restore the roof’s stability and safety.
This service helps solve several common issues that homeowners may encounter. A sagging roof can lead to uneven or cracked ceilings, water pooling on the roof surface, or leaks that cause interior damage. Over time, the structural weakness may worsen, increasing the risk of more extensive and costly repairs. Sagging can also diminish the overall appearance of a property and reduce its value. Professional repair services typically involve reinforcing or replacing weakened framing components, leveling the roof surface, and ensuring proper drainage to prevent future problems.

The overview below groups typical Sagging Roof Repair proj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Renton, WA.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Fixing minor sagging issues or replacing a few shingles typically costs between $250 and $600. Many routine repairs fall within this range, depending on the extent of the damage and materials needed.
Moderate Repairs - Addressing more significant sagging or localized sections can range from $600 to $2,000. These projects are common and usually involve replacing damaged roofing sections or reinforcing weakened areas.
Partial Roof Replacement - Replacing a portion of the roof due to extensive sagging generally costs between $2,000 and $5,000. Larger, more complex projects tend to push costs toward the higher end of this range.
Full Roof Replacement - Complete roof overhauls due to severe sagging or aging often start around $8,000 and can exceed $15,000. These are less frequent but necessary for long-term durability and safety.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What are the signs of a sagging roof? Common indicators include visible sagging or dips in the roofline, cracked or broken shingles, and water stains or leaks inside the property, which may suggest structural issues needing repair.
Why is it important to address a sagging roof? Fixing a sagging roof helps prevent further structural damage, reduces the risk of leaks, and maintains the safety and integrity of the building.
What causes roofs to sag? Roof sagging can result from prolonged exposure to moisture, weakened or damaged rafters, poor installation, or the accumulation of heavy snow or debris over time.
How do local contractors repair a sagging roof? They typically assess the damage, reinforce or replace weakened framing, and ensure the roof structure is properly supported to restore stability and prevent future issues.
Can a sagging roof be repaired without replacing the entire roof? Yes, many sagging roofs can be repaired through structural reinforcement or targeted repairs to the affected areas, avoiding the need for full roof replacement.
